By AdminOver the years Colombia has become one of the best medical tourism destinations for all types of cosmetic surgery procedures. Due to the huge numbers of surgeries performed in Colombia, the Colombian doctors and nurses are highly trained, fully practiced and experienced to ensure that their medical skills and knowledge meet the international standards.
Miami, FL, June 26, 2009 --(PR.com)-- We’ve been living with an old and a famous phrase since our school days which says ‘practice makes a man perfect’. The phrase becomes apt in any field of life and when it comes to the medical profession, a big amount of practice is, certainly, needed to perform those difficult and delicate surgeries.
Cosmetic Surgery is no exception for that matter. Apparently, Cosmetic Harmony Inc., a Colombia based medical tourism company, highly regards their experienced surgeons and credits the company’s success to them...more
